Transaction

2961e07eccde33b138c63e4ce85fb2efe89a0ad18bde41e6f4efe332cce3e925

Summary

In Block889341
TimeSat, 28 Sep 2024 11:07:15 UTC
Total Input2456.60146931 Nebula
Total Output2477.60146931 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
1309 Confirmations2477.60146931 Nebula
Raw Transaction